Some AI agents have started inventing shared vocabulary that their human monitors can read, but may not reliably understand. In experiments by Emergence, autonomous agents from several frontier model families formed common phrases and communication conventions within days, without being told or rewarded to create a language. The terms were specific to each group. DeepSeek-based agents called a tool-building agent a “forge-smith.” Anthropic-based agents used “name-first” for attaching an agent’s name to a claim as a sign of accountability. Google-based agents used “kintsugi” to describe system resilience. Other agents then adopted those meanings. Emergence executive chair Satya Nitta says the concern is not that the agents were hiding a purpose. The conversations remained visible. The problem is that a shared code could become increasingly opaque while still looking like an ordinary log. Niall Curry, a linguist at the University of Birmingham, said agents might compress language to save computation and communicate more efficiently—while making it harder for monitors to determine what actually happened. The experiment found no evidence of hidden goals or harmful actions, and it does not show that these dialects will appear in deployed systems. But it points to a specific safety constraint: monitoring may need to test whether agents’ shared meanings remain understandable, not merely whether their messages are recorded. OpenAI chief scientist Jakub Pachocki has separately stressed the importance of confidence in monitoring systems’ reasoning. The open question is whether readable logs will still be useful when the vocabulary inside them evolves faster than human oversight.

Researchers at Emergence say autonomous AI agents placed in cooperative experimental societies began creating shared phrases and meanings within days, without being instructed or rewarded to invent a language. The agents’ language also grew more opaque as they communicated, creating a potential obstacle for human oversight.

The experiment involved autonomous agents powered by frontier models from companies in the US, China and France. Emergence executive chair Satya Nitta said the agents developed conventions themselves and that other agents then adopted them. The finding concerns behavior in an experiment, rather than evidence that agents were concealing a purpose from people.

How a shared code took shape

The vocabulary was not merely technical shorthand. Researchers said DeepSeek-based agents used “forge-smith” for an agent that builds tools for others. Anthropic-based agents used “name-first” for an agent demonstrating accountability by attaching its name to a claim, while Google-based agents used “kintsugi” to mean system resilience.

Seeing a conversation is not the same as understanding it

Nitta’s concern is not that the conversations became invisible. He said their conventions could evolve until people could observe the exchanges but struggle to understand what they meant. That distinction matters for systems intended to act with some autonomy: a readable log is a weaker safeguard when its language is no longer interpretable.

Niall Curry, a linguist at the University of Birmingham, said agents may streamline language to reduce computation costs and improve efficiency. He also said unintelligible exchanges could leave monitors unable to determine what agents had actually done. Efficiency and oversight, in other words, may pull in opposite directions.

The unresolved test for monitoring

The report does not establish that these emergent terms enabled harmful actions, or that they will appear in deployed systems. It does raise a narrower operational question: whether safety monitoring needs to assess shared meanings, not simply preserve access to messages. OpenAI chief scientist Jakub Pachocki has separately warned that confidence in monitoring AI systems’ thinking is essential for safe development and may constrain progress. Emergence’s result suggests that interpreting agent-to-agent language could become part of that constraint.
